Top US congressmen introduce bill to reduce green card backlog


Washington, DC: Three influential Congressmen, including Indian-Americans Raja Krishnamoorthi and Pramila Jayapal, have introduced bipartisan legislation in the US House of Representatives to reduce green card backlog and end country-based discrimination for employment-based visas.  Both the moves, if passed and signed into law, would help thousands of Indian-Americans who are currently in decades-long wait for green cards or permanent residency. Dr. Jasvant Modi donates $800K to introduce Jain Studies at CSUN


Northridge, CA: California State University, Northridge (CSUN) has announced the substantial donation of $800,000 by Dr. Jasvant Modi, a retired gastroenterologist and philanthropist, and his wife Dr. Meera Modi. The funds are designated to support the Bhagvan Ajitnath Endowed Professorship in Jain Studies within the Department of Religious Studies, College of Humanities.
